Synonyms[edit]

For future reference, according to this website the following binomials should not be listed as species:

  • O. tenimberensis Niepelt, 1934 (subspecies of O. astrophela)
  • O. banksi (synonym of O. helena)
  • O. intermedia (synonym of O. helena)
  • O. pluto (synonym of O. helena)
  • O. simplex (synonym of O. astrophela)
  • O. subcostimacula (synonym of O. helena)
  • O. varicolor (synonym of O. astrophela)
